Join us as we explore possible models for curating art and the formation of ecological contexts in Southeast Asia! We’ll discuss the relationships between artists and their production environments, as well as the dynamics of species movement.

This forum will extend the discussion in relation to the exhibition “Stemflow”, organised by Osage Art Foundation wrapped up in late Mar 2025, in which the project has tried to open up the region to other locations of the southeast in the world through the concept of the southeast.
